One of the goals of health care transformation is to garner the ability to personalize care for an individual patient. In the current scenario, big data is poised to make a significant contribution toward this goal. It has the potential to create significant value in health care by improving outcomes while lowering costs. Big data's defining features include the ability to handle massive data volume and variety at high velocity. New, flexible, and easily expandable information technology (IT) infrastructure, including so-called data lakes and cloud data storage and management solutions, make big-data analytics possible. The data have been collected from various sources and analyzed. The conclusion of the paper is that the database will help clinicians and researchers better understand the genetic causes of the patient's diseases andother rare condition related to it. Based on this data, it is believed that new drugs, treatments, and therapies can be developed and patients can receive targeted therapies that may prove more effective.
